Butter biscuits<br />

You will need:<br />

200 g butter<br />

100 g icing sugar, sifted<br />

1 packet vanilla sugar<br />

1 Egg yoke<br />

300 g fl our<br />

Cream the butter, sifted icing<br />

sugar, vanilla sugar and<br />

egg yoke. Sift the fl our and<br />

gradually kneed it into the<br />

dough. Shape the dough<br />

into a big ball and put it into<br />

the fridge for about one<br />

hour. Read below to see<br />

what you have to do next.<br />

Almond biscuits<br />

You will need:<br />

125 g butter<br />

125 g icing sugar, sifted<br />

1 egg<br />

1 egg yoke<br />

1 packet vanilla sugar<br />

250 g fl our<br />

75 g grated almonds<br />

Cream the butter, icing sugar,<br />

vanilla sugar, egg and egg<br />

yoke. Gradually fold in the<br />

sifted fl our and add the grated<br />

almonds until you have<br />

a smooth and even dough.<br />

Shape the dough into a big<br />

ball and put it into the fridge<br />

for about one hour.<br />

What to do next:<br />

Now cut out two pieces of<br />

baking paper to measure approximately<br />

40 x 40 cm. Put<br />

the ball of dough between<br />

the two pieces of baking<br />

paper and roll it out – but<br />

not too thin! Now you can<br />

start cutting out the biscuits.
